Job Description
- Maintain working theatrical spaces at NHS Newman and Pollard to ensure safety and functionality across the schools; this position focuses only the theatricallighting and sound components of the auditorium spaces
- Monitors and inventories the condition of equipment including lighting sound rigging equipment and theatrical draperies/ curtains.
- Arranges for the repair and replacement of theatrical equipment with budgetary constraints as directed by the FPA Director.
- Performs preventive maintenance of equipment in the HS Newman and Pollard Auditoriums.
- Provide supervision of student actors and technical theater students during productions.
- At tech week rehearsals and performance for all school productions.
- Provides technical rehearsal notes to show Directors.
- Train and supervise students Fine and Performing arts staff in the safe and correct use of stage lighting and sound equipment.
- Execute the technical elements of light sound and rigging for all Performing Arts Department theatrical productions
- Coordinate with the Set Director regarding purchasing of materials and build days
Desired Skills:
- Proficient with console programming LED and moving lights.
- Proficient with sound consoles.
- Stay current with technical theater trends and technology.
- Ability to work nights and weekends.
- Moderate physical effort which may include frequent standing or walking handling objects up to 50 lbs occasional climbing crawling or stooping working at heights on ladders catwalks and lifts and the use of medium weight tools and materials.
- Capable of offering budget recommendations to the Director of FPA for upkeep of technical equipment.
- Excellent organizational and time management skills.
- Love of theater and working with students.
- Excellent communication skills both verbal and written.
- The ability to build a strong rapport with colleagues and serve as a collaborative team player.
